Osaka · Nishitanabe

Coffee Long Season

Takuya Okita opened Coffee Long Season in Nishitanabe on February 9, 2022, taking over a kissaten space that had already been serving the neighborhood coffee for sixty years rather than starting from empty. He brought eight years at Osaka's Tamakura Coffee Roasters and two more at Coffee County in his native Fukuoka into a small room built around a Probat roaster in the corner, a Scandinavian sofa and a hand carved bear.

The shop is named for a Fishmans song from the nineties, and that same unhurried mood carries into the coffee, a tightly edited pour over list running through lots like Colombia El Naranjo Pink Bourbon, Ethiopia Tabe Burka and Kenya Ruarai. Homemade cheesecake is the one steady food item, and vinyl on the turntable fills in the rest of the room.
